Job Description
Your Career
Are you passionate about taking automation to the next level? Do you live and breathe the cyber security world? Do you want to take part in an innovative and disruptive team that will have an impact on the lives of many customers?
As a Cloud Cybersecurity Researcher, you will design and implement remediation strategies for cloud runtime and posture issues, ensuring responses are as autonomous, effective, and safe as possible. You will collaborate with leading security experts, leverage cutting-edge technologies, and contribute to the vision of an Autonomous SOC.
Your Impact
- Develop robust, testable, and safe remediation plans for cloud runtime and posture issues (CSPM, DSPM, CIEM, CNAPP, IAM, etc.)
- Conduct in-depth research to identify attacker TTPs and cloud misconfiguration risks, and translate findings into automated response playbooks
- Apply data analysis, programming, and modeling techniques to evaluate and optimize remediation approaches
- Collaborate within a diverse research group to continuously improve automation processes and methodologies
- Stay ahead of evolving threats, including cloud-native attack vectors and advanced adversary tradecraft
Qualifications
Your Experience
- Strong background in cloud security operations and incident resolution
- Deep expertise in at least one of the following: incident response, red teaming, or advanced threat hunting/detection research
- Hands-on experience with cloud platforms (AWS, GCP, or Azure) and associated security services
- Proficiency in Python and practical experience building automation or playbooks
- Experience working with SQL or similar query languages for large-scale data analysis
- Strong analytical skills, independent thinking, and ability to collaborate in a team environment
Advantages
- Experience with big data platforms (e.g., GCP BigQuery, AWS Athena)
- Familiarity with security tools such as XDR, EDR, CSPM, DSPM, CNAPP, CIEM, and SOAR
- Deep knowledge of attacker techniques, cloud-native threats, and mitigation strategies
- Experience with machine learning or data-driven security analysis
